Shift Processing, also known as Shift Management or Time Tracking Software, is a type of technology designed to streamline and optimize workforce management for various industries. The primary function of shift processing software is to manage employee schedules, attendance, and time-off requests in a centralized and automated manner.

Here's how it typically works:

  • Scheduling: Employers can create and schedule shifts using the software, taking into account factors such as staffing needs, team availability, and work requirements.
  • Time Tracking: Employees are assigned to specific tasks or shifts, which are tracked in real-time using mobile apps, web portals, or desktop software. This allows for accurate recording of working hours, breaks, and time off.
  • Attendance Management: The system tracks employee attendance, automatically detecting absences, tardiness, and overtime. This information is used to generate reports and identify patterns for improvement.
  • Leave Requests: Employees can submit leave requests, which are reviewed and approved by managers or administrators using the software's workflow management features.

Shift processing software offers numerous benefits to organizations, including:

  • Improved productivity: By automating scheduling, time tracking, and attendance management, shift processing software helps reduce administrative tasks and increase employee focus on core responsibilities.
  • Enhanced workforce planning: The system provides real-time insights into staffing needs, allowing employers to make more informed decisions about recruitment, training, and deployment of resources.
  • Better employee engagement: Shift processing software enables employees to access their schedules, track work hours, and request time off through user-friendly interfaces, improving overall job satisfaction and reducing conflicts.
  • Compliance management: The system helps organizations meet regulatory requirements related to labor laws, taxes, and benefits by providing accurate records of employment data.
